Aldar Sells AED 3.5B in Homes on Wellness-Focused Fahid Island

Aldar, one of the UAE’s leading real estate developers, has announced that it generated over AED 3.5 billion in sales during the launch week of Fahid Island, Abu Dhabi’s first coastal wellness destination and the world’s first Fitwel certified island.

The milestone figure was driven by strong demand for the first two residential developments on the island — Fahid Beach Residences and The Beach House — both of which blend luxury waterfront living with a wellness-focused lifestyle. Positioned as a global benchmark in integrated wellness and sustainable living, Fahid Island is rapidly emerging as a high-profile investment and residential destination.

In a statement, Aldar confirmed that 67% of buyers were first-time customers and that nearly half (42%) of purchasers were under the age of 45 — highlighting growing interest in wellness-led living among younger investors. International demand also proved strong, with expatriates and overseas buyers accounting for 67% of total sales. Top buyer nationalities included residents from the UAE, Russia, the UK, and China.

“The highly anticipated launch of Fahid Island has resulted in the first homes released generating more than AED 3.5 billion — and serves as a powerful validation of our vision to place wellness at the heart of community living,” said Jonathan Emery, CEO of Aldar Development. “The success reflects Abu Dhabi’s position as one of the world’s most desirable investment and lifestyle destinations.”

Aldar accelerated the launch of The Beach House, the island’s second residential phase, in response to overwhelming demand. The development includes 11 towers offering a mix of studios and three-bedroom + maid apartments, with interiors inspired by coastal elegance and designed to evoke calm and clarity. Residents will enjoy direct shoreline access, panoramic views of the Abu Dhabi skyline, and a full range of modern wellness-focused amenities.

Fahid Island’s masterplan includes Coral Drive, a boutique retail boulevard, and the prestigious King’s College School Wimbledon, underscoring Aldar’s aim to create a holistic live-work-learn environment. The integration of education, nature, wellness, and lifestyle places Fahid Island in line with global trends that prioritise community and sustainability in luxury development.

Aldar plans further residential launches on the island in the months ahead, continuing its mission to redefine coastal living in the region through innovative, wellness-first urban design.

As the UAE expands its footprint as a global hub for lifestyle-driven investment, Fahid Island is shaping up to be one of its most significant and forward-thinking real estate developments to date.
